Number of Awards & Eligibility: The number of awards offered varies annually. In previous years, seven scholarships have been awarded.
In order to qualify, students must meet the following criteria:
  1. This award is for U.S. students.
  2. Must be a U.S. citizen or permanent resident.
  3. Must have a grade point average of 3.5 or higher. Consideration will be given to students with a grade point average of 3.2 to 3.49 under special circumstances.
  4. Must be enrolled in one of the following Bay Area public universities: California State University, East Bay; San Francisco State University; San Jose State University; Sonoma State University or University of California, Berkeley.
  5. Must major in one of the following fields: social sciences, human services, health-related fields and/or public service.
  6. Must be an upper division student who has attended the school for one academic year or more, with 24 units that were attained at the present university

Description: This award is available for current juniors and seniors attending one of the following universities: California State University, East Bay; San Francisco State University; San Jose State University; Sonoma State University or University of California, Berkeley. The applicant must have a grade point average of 3.5 or higher and be majoring in social sciences, human services, health-related fields or public service.

Application requirements for the New Leader Scholarship are:

  • Essay
  • Recommendation letter
  • Official Transcript
Additional Information: Applicants must demonstrate financial need. The fund is especially designed to provide aid to students who come from financially and educationally disadvantaged backgrounds and demonstrate leadership capacities. Preference and priority are given to recent immigrants and students of color. Students should be planning to pursue advanced education in the social sciences, human services, health-related fields or public service and be able to demonstrate a commitment to serving others. Students will be expected to remain connected to The New Leader Scholarship Fund and awardees' network in order to contribute to the goals of the fund. If selected as an eligible scholarship candidate, the student is required to attend a mandatory interview with the scholarship committee.

Award Amount: Up to $8,000 annually, renewable for up to three additional years if the student maintains his/her grade point average, continues to demonstrate financial need, and remains enrolled in an undergraduate and/or graduate program with satisfactory progress.  The total dollars awarded for this scholarship is $8,000.

Applications are available on the New Leader Scholarship website. In addition to the completed application, the following materials must be submitted: an official transcript; two letters of recommendation, one of which must be from a faculty member in the student's area of interest; and an essay of 700 words or less addressing the topic listed on the application. The completed application and supporting materials must be postmarked by the deadline date and sent to the address provided.
